Is Our Ethics Who We Are Or What We Do?

This week’s question is about what defines our ethics – “Is our ethics based on who we are or what we do?” Some people would argue that we have a persona, a manner, that is either ethical or not. Others would say that it is our decisions and actions that define how ethical we are, and therefore our ethicality changes from moment to moment.

Instead of trying to decide which perspective is right, we would be well advised to take our lead from Aristotle. He conveyed in his famous quote “we are what we repeatedly do” that our ethical persona and actions cannot be separated.
